We’re looking for a talented individual to join our Rider Onboarding and Compliance Team. This is a bustling and vibrant team that helps applicants become riders to ensure we have enough riders in the fleet to supply customer demand and proactively ensure riders remain in service and compliant during their time with Deliveroo. What You’ll Be Doing

You’ll be joining the Rider Onboarding Operations team, working at the forefront of complex and high-impact cases. Here’s what your day-to-day might look like:

  • Own the rider onboarding journey end-to-end, removing friction for applicants and maintaining healthy rider fleet levels to meet customer demand.

  • Monitor supply pacing and pipeline metrics across assigned markets, taking proactive steps to keep recruitment targets on track.

  • Coordinate daily with external vendors and internal teams to align on operational focuses, track task completion, and resolve blockers.

  • Audit and optimise onboarding workflows, identifying system inefficiencies and proposing practical solutions to improve funnel conversion.

  • Support cross-market supply pipelines, acting as a reliable operational expert to assist various international markets with their unique onboarding flows.

Deliveroo is an award-winning delivery service founded in 2013 by William Shu and Greg Orlowski. Deliveroo works with approximately 176,000 best-loved restaurants and grocery partners, as well as around 150,000 riders to provide the best food delivery experience in the world. Deliveroo is headquartered in London, with offices around the globe. Deliveroo operates across 10 markets, including Belgium, France, Hong Kong, Italy, Ireland, Qatar, Singapore, United Arab Emirates, Kuwait and the United Kingdom.
